Output efd4173a33e96099ad2f9209d204d7f6510fa2647776f9997f7a0f89d0adaeba:8

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 343a27100088aba9bc4a9481750562f5fb6bae02 OP_EQUAL
address
MCfK2vCT8fq1w1RZC4APHrX33wt7bWXCkB
transaction
efd4173a33e96099ad2f9209d204d7f6510fa2647776f9997f7a0f89d0adaeba
spent
true